Write a report on a recording of a musical work or a movement of a musical work.

The first ILR is a report on a physical recording (CD, DVD, VHS) of a musical work. The work must be "art music" as defined in class and in the text The Enjoyment of Music. The work may not be chosen from those included in your textbook's Listening Guides. Suggested works come from the following.

Symphonies, operas, chamber music, concert band music, solo vocal or instrumental works.

To find works of this nature, look in the "classical" section of the CD collection in your local library. DVD's and VHS's are usually shelved according to "opera", "chamber music", etc. The librarian or the catalog on computer will be able to assist you in finding Dewey Decimal numbers for works of art music. As a starting point, music is cataloged in the 780's.

As you listen to your chosen work, take notes. Plan to listen to it at least twice. This will give you a clearer picture of the organization of the work, compositional elements used by the composer, and a fair idea of the work's overall impact. To be"fair" to the work, never evaluate it on the basis of one hearing.

SETTING UP YOUR REPORT

Your report should include, but need not be limited to, the following information.

I. A short introductory paragraph including:

A. The composer and name of the work.

B. The historical style period of the work, and the composer's birth/death dates.

C. The type of work. (Symphony, concerto, brass quintet, etc.)

II. A description of the work. THIS IS THE MOST IMPORTANT SECTION OF YOUR REPORT AND IS WEIGHTED THE MOST HEAVILY.

A. Beginning

1. Dynamics, tempo, instruments/voices, ranges

2. Was there an opening theme? How was it stated?

B. Development

1. What kind of form is evident in this work?

2. How did the composer use repetition, contrast, or variation?

3. How did the composer bring the work to a satisfying end?

III. Conclusion

What did you think of this work? This composer, based on this work? Would you check out another recording by him/her? Did you enjoy this style period?
